THE TEAM NEWS
NAPOLI
- Napoli's fate remains firmly in their own hands as they bid to progress to the knockout stages of the UCL despite their poor recent form.
- Napoli are now on a run of nine matches without a victory in all competitions with their last win coming on matchday 3 against Salzburg.
- If Napoli are to pick up the point they need, they may have to do so without influential midfielder Allan who is an injury doubt.

GENK
- Genk cannot progress from Group E but will be desperate to end their campaign on a high having earned just one point so far.
- The Belgian side have endured a poor run of late but earned their first win in nine matches in all competitions by winning at the weekend.
- Genk have a relatively healthy squad with long-term absentees Danny Vukovic and Bryan Heynen sidelined along with Jere Uronen.

THE PREDICTION
Napoli are yet to lose in this season's UCL but their overall form over the last couple of months has been worrying. They have not won any of their last nine in all competitions but against a Genk side without a win in this season's competition, the Italians should finally end their awful run.
